    Supporting a Parent With Dementia When You’re Living Apart with Laura Smothers-Chu

    In this episode of Sacred Work in Progress, Bonnie is joined by dementia coach and advocate Laura Smothers-Chu, founder of Joy in Dementia. Laura specializes in helping adult children who are supporting a parent with dementia when they do not live in the same home. Laura’s dad was diagnosed with dementia when she was twenty-eight. Even working in healthcare, she could not find resources that spoke to her experience as a daughter living apart from her parents. Everything was geared toward the primary caregiver under the same roof. So she created what she needed and now guides other long distance caregivers through both the practical logistics and the emotional weight of this journey.
